INTI Penang Car Park Facilities A Big Let Down

After a year of studies in my college, I have observed and heard about the students' views and opinions about the college facilities. What are they disappointed of anyway? Well, most of the students are very much disappointed about the car park facilities that has very limited parking space. As you know, the students in college keep increasing every year, and so do the number of cars in the college. Why is this so happening?





FYI, the reason I post this is to how to solve this parking problem with just only a limited space available. Please don't hate me because I don't hate them, I was just feeling disappointed only. Btw, do you know what did the college management suggested for students about car park? Obviously, they encourage us to car pool to college so that they can increase a little bit parking space. But for me, I don't think car pooling will be effective enough since most of the students drive alone, without any passenger. So what if the college has over 1000 students with each driving a car, and the parking lot has only 200? The remaining students who can't find any parking space will left their car either alongside the road or the hostel parking area, that means they have to go for a distance walk to the college.
